River drew and Boca lost: what Demichelis and Martinez said in the run-up to the Superclasico

Neither of them could win and they arrive at next Sunday’s Superclásico with different sensations. River lost to Banfield, and in the end, they got an agonizing 1-1 draw at the Monumental. Meanwhile, Boca suffered a double slap in the face from Lanús and in the closing found the discount that served only to decorate the final 2-1. Thus, both Martín Demichelis and Diego Martínez analysed the team’s performance and talked about the upcoming duel. The best moments of the draw between River and Banfield”Tonight I’ll review the game we played today and what the opponent can do. But I imagine River as the protagonist. We’re going to have the satisfaction of playing in a packed stadium, with the fans rooting for us. But I told the boys that you have to play well on matchday 6 before you get to matchday 7. We didn’t win, but I think there were good things,” said the millionaire coach, who is excited about the possibility of having Miguel Borja, who has a muscle injury. The best moments of Boca’s defeat against LanúsFor his part, the coach lamented the defeat but said that he will quickly look to turn the page and put his mind on the classic. “It’s a very important week. From tomorrow we’ll have our minds on that, but it hurts us to have lost points here, not to have scored and it’s still a bit hot to analyse what I think of the team in today’s match. From tomorrow we will start as we always do, knowing what this match means. We’re going to have a long work week,” he said.
